Features
n ICC reduced by 50% n Outputs source/sink 24 mA n ’ACT00 has TTL-compatible inputs n Standard Microcircuit Drawing (SMD) — ’AC00: 5962-87549 — ’ACT00: 5962-87699 n 54AC00 now qualified to 300Krad RHA designation, refer to the SMD for more information Logic Symbol IEEE/IEC 10025701 Pin Names Description An,B n Inputs On Outputs Connection Diagrams Pin Assignment for DIP and Flatpak Pin Assignment for LCC 10025703 10025702 FACT® is a registered trademark of Fairchild Semiconductor Corporation. July 2003 54AC00/54ACT00 Quad 2-Input NAND Gate © 2003 National Semiconductor Corporation DS100257 www.national.com
Absolute Maximum Ratings (Note 1) If Military/Aerospace specified devices are required, please contact the National Semiconductor Sales Office/ Distributors for availability and specifications. Supply Voltage (V CC) −0.5V to +7.0V DC Input Diode Current (I IK) VI = −0.5V −20 mA VI =V CC + 0.5V +20 mA DC Input Voltage (VI) −0.5V to V CC + 0.5V DC Output Diode Current (I OK) VO = −0.5V −20 mA VO =V CC + 0.5V +20 mA DC Output Voltage (VO) −0.5V to V CC + 0.5V DC Output Source or Sink Current (I O) ±50 mA DC VCC or Ground Current per Output Pin (I CC or IGND) ±50 mA Storage Temperature (TSTG) −65˚C to +150˚C Junction Temperature (TJ) CDIP 175˚C Recommended Operating Conditions Supply Voltage (VCC) ’AC 2.0V to 6.0V ’ACT 4.5V to 5.5V Input Voltage (V I) 0 Vt oV CC Output Voltage (VO) 0 Vt oV CC Operating Temperature (TA) 54AC/ACT −55˚C to +125˚C Minimum Input Edge Rate ( ∆V/∆t) ’AC Devices V IN from 30% to 70% of V CC VCC @ 3.3V, 4.5V, 5.5V 125 mV/ns Minimum Input Edge Rate ( ∆V/∆t) ’ACT Devices V IN from 0.8V to 2.0V VCC @ 4.5V, 5.5V 125 mV/ns Note 1: Absolute maximum ratings are those values beyond which damage to the device may occur. The databook specifications should be met, without exception, to ensure that the system design is reliable over its power supply, temperature, and output/input loading variables. National does not recom- mend operation of FACT ® circuits outside databook specifications.
